SEE (Signing Exact English) is much like ASL (American Sign Language) just that it requires (as it's called) the person to sign word for word instead of just the general idea. For example, the term, "I watched the movies yesterday" would be signed in ASL as "Yesterday, watched movie" while SEE would cover the complete sentence.
